Another highlight is our poster session on 7 May 2026, starting at 5:30 p.m., on the topic of “Multiple Color Matching Function 2D Colorimetry”. We will present an imaging measurement method that enables 2D colorimetry using multiple color matching functions from a single image. The goal is to improve color accuracy, reduce observer metamerism, and increase the visual consistency of modern displays.

Instrument Systems GmbH, founded in Munich in 1986, develops and produces high-end light measurement technology that is indispensable for manufacturers of consumer electronics, (AR/VR) displays, Micro(O)LED wafers, VCSEL/laser systems, automotive lighting and LED/SSL modules. All solutions benefit from the CAS series of high-precision spectroradiometers that are widely recognized and used worldwide. In combination with 2D imaging colorimeters, integrating spheres and goniometer systems, they enable high-precision and accurate measurements in the entire spectral range from UV to IR, traceable to PTB or NIST. Today, Instrument Systems is one of the world’s leading manufacturers of light measurement technology. At its Berlin facility, the “Optronik Line” of products is developed and marketed for the automotive industry and traffic technology. The subsidiary in Korea supplements the product portfolio with the “Kimsoptec Line” for the Korean light & display market. Instrument Systems has been a wholly-owned subsidiary of the Konica MinoIta Group since 2012.
